On October 31, the end of the first month of operations, Morristown & Co. prepared the following income statement based on absorption costing: Morristown & Co. Absorption Costing Income Statement For Month Ended October 31, 20-- Sales (2,600 units) $117,000 Cost of goods sold: Cost of goods manufactured $85,500 Less ending inventory (400 units) 11,400 Cost of goods sold 74,100 Gross profit $42,900 Selling and administrative expenses 21,500 Income from operations $21,400 If the fixed manufacturing costs were $42,900 and the variable selling and administrative expenses were $14,600, prepare an income statement using variable costing.
